The unemployment rate in Cadillac, MI, is 14.30%, with job growth of -3.26%. Future job growth over the next ten years is predicted to be 19.18%.
Cadillac, MI Taxes
Cadillac, MI,sales tax rate is 6.00%. Income tax is 4.35%.
Cadillac, MI Income and Salaries
The income per capita is $18,898, which includes all adults and children. The median household income is $34,281.
